A/Prof Likui WANG

Associate Professor, Institute of Microbiology, Chinese Academy of Sciences

Vaccinology Education, Medical School, University of Chinese Academy of Sciences

Secretary-General, CAS-TWAS Centre of Excellence for Emerging Infectious Disease


Dr. Likui Wang is a research scientist dedicated to advancing global health security through interdisciplinary research at the interface of vaccinology, molecular diagnostics, and pandemic preparedness. His work is strategically focused on addressing the critical challenges posed by emerging and re-emerging infectious diseases.

His primary research areas include:

  • Clinical Development of Vaccines against Emerging Pathogens: Spearheading research in the clinical development of vaccines for emerging and re-emerging infectious diseases, with a particular emphasis on translating novel vaccine candidates from bench to bedside. This includes a strong focus on the design and execution of clinical trials to evaluate safety, immunogenicity, and efficacy.
  • Molecular Diagnostics for Pathogen Detection: Developing and refining advanced molecular diagnostic platforms for the rapid and accurate detection of emerging pathogenic microorganisms. His work in this area aims to enable early warning, real-time surveillance, and effective containment of disease outbreaks.
  • Global Vaccinology and Immunization Strategies: Investigating global vaccinology education, policy, and implementation frameworks to enhance vaccine confidence, coverage, and equitable access worldwide. His research informs the development of effective immunization strategies tailored for diverse populations and resource settings.
  • International Collaboration and Translational Research: Actively fostering international scientific partnerships and technology transfer to accelerate the translation of research discoveries into tangible public health tools, including diagnostics, therapeutics, and vaccines.
  • Pandemic Prevention and Health Systems Resilience: Dedicated to the study of pandemic prevention frameworks and health systems strengthening. His work focuses on developing robust response systems for pandemics, including early warning systems, scalable countermeasure manufacturing, and coordinated global response mechanisms.
  • Broad-Spectrum Vaccine R&D and Outbreak Response Systems: Concentrating on the rational design and development of broad-spectrum vaccines capable of providing cross-protection against divergent viral families. This is complemented by research into integrated outbreak response systems that enhance global resilience against major infectious disease pandemics, aiming to provide critical technological innovations and strategic guidance for global pandemic prevention efforts.

Through this integrated portfolio, Dr. Wang’s research provides key technological solutions and strategic insights to support the global community in predicting, preparing for, and mitigating the impact of future large-scale infectious disease emergencies.
